Sterilizing equipment provides medical safety of patients, medical practitioners, and the environment by fighting against healthcare-associated infections (HAIs), which hospital patients get during their hospital stay. Surgical instruments, contaminated equipment can cause HAIs. Sterilizing equipment eliminates microorganisms such as bacteria, viruses, fungi, spores, unicellular eukaryotic organisms present in a specific surface, object, or fluid. Sterilization is done through heat, irradiation, high pressure, chemicals, and filtration.

Sterilization equipment is used to kill harmful bacteria, viruses, fungi, and spores on the medical equipment or other item placed inside a pressure vessel. Sterilization equipment helps to prevent the spread of healthcare-associated infections (HAIs) from contaminated equipment and surgical instruments. HAIs are the infections that patients get during treatment for medical or surgical conditions. For instance,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imates that around 1.7 million people contract HAIs, and about 99,000 of those cases result in death each year in American hospitals alone.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), around 4.1 million people in Europe are affected by healthcare-associated infections each year. According to the Studies conducted in hospitals, 5% to 10% of hospitalizations in Europe and North America result in Healthcare-Associated Infection (HAI). In regions like Latin America, Sub-Saharan Africa, and Asia, it’s more than 40% result in Healthcare-Associated Infection (HAI). The rising incidence of healthcare-associated infections has increased the demand for sterilization equipment.

Heat Sterilization Instruments (Dry Heat Sterilization Instruments and Steam Sterilization Instruments), Low-Temperature Sterilization Instruments (Ethylene Oxide Sterilization Instruments, Formaldehyde Sterilization Instruments, Hydrogen Peroxide Plasma Sterilization Instruments, Ozone-Based Sterilization Instruments, and Others), Radiation Sterilization Instruments (Gamma Radiation Sterilization Instruments, E-Beam Radiation Sterilization Instruments, and X-ray Sterilization Instruments), and Filtration Sterilization Instruments is the product type segment of the market scope. By service type, the market is divided into E-Beam Sterilization Services, Gamma Radiation Sterilization Services, X-Ray Sterilization Services, Ethylene Oxide Sterilization Services, and Others. By consumables and accessories, the market is further divided into Sterilization Indicators, Sterilant Cassettes, Sterilization Containers, Pouches, and Others. By end-users, the global Sterilization Equipment market is divided into Hospitals & Clinics, Pharmaceutical Companies, Medical Device Companies, Laboratories, and Others.
